Well, it turned out the processor was the issue the whole time! This board is probably fine!
DIMM A2 defective on arrival on that board. DIMM B2 worked fine, but if only one out of 2 Memory slots work then what is the point? I tried and updated the BIOS successfully but that did not fix the issue. I tried a different brand of RAM: same issue. I tried with the built-in graphic chipset and one of my trusted graphics cards: same issue. I even tried 3 different power supplies with the last one being a 1000 watt one: same thing. DIMM B2 worked but as soon as you put a Memory stick into A2, no go. I even tried to loosen the heatsink as suggested on numerous forums, still no luck. I tried everything short of a different processor, which I don't have any spares laying around. I usually am happy with and got lucky with MSI products throughout the years, but I'm going to RMA that one unfortunately and go with something else. For the positive, Bios was easy to update and easy to navigate through and seemed pretty stable. If you can get your MOBO to work this would be a great buy, but there's always that possibility that you might have to RMA it.UPDATE:It turned out the Processor was the issue. There probably was nothing wrong with the board. I ordered a different board from MSI and got the same issue. I ordered a new AMD processor, got it all set up last night and we are in business!Ver másVer menos
